ABSTRACT:
A scale modifying circuit for providing either expanded or compressed scale readings on a conventional electrical indicating instrument. The device includes a pair of input terminals adapted to be connected to a source of voltage to be monitored or measured, a voltage responsive network connected with one of said input terminals for supplying output voltage to output terminals of the device, and amplifier means driven from the input terminals and having an output connected to supply a driving voltage to at least one of the output terminals. Expanded scales (or compressed scales) can be provided at the lower, middle, or high end of a particular range of voltages being monitored, or at intermediate points. This results in higher resolution over the expanded scale portion, together with improved accuracy. An illustrated embodiment of the invention embraces a voltage-limiting diode, to effect a cut-off of an ascending applied voltage. Some embodiments involve cascaded and summing amplifiers, negative feedback circuits, and multi-coil instrument movements where the coils are involved with the feedback.
